Factors to Consider When Choosing a Freeze Alarm Sensor for Pipes Under Sink
When choosing a freeze alarm sensor for pipes under your sink, you should consider several key factors. Sensor sensitivity levels and alarm volume can greatly impact how quickly you respond to a potential issue. Additionally, look into wireless connectivity options, battery life, and the waterproof rating to guarantee you’re getting a reliable device.
Sensor Sensitivity Levels
How sensitive should a freeze alarm sensor be to effectively protect your pipes under the sink? You’ll want a sensor that activates when temperatures drop to around 37°F (3°C) or lower, providing an early warning to avoid pipe damage. Higher sensitivity levels allow for quicker response times, which is vital in preventing costly issues. Placement is key; position the sensor in areas most at risk, like under sinks or near exterior walls. Consider advanced sensors that use multiple probes for enhanced detection capabilities, ensuring they can identify freezing conditions in varying environments. Regular testing and maintenance are essential to keep your sensor responsive to temperature changes, so don’t overlook this important step.
Alarm Volume Specifications
Alarm volume specifications are essential factors to take into account in selecting a freeze alarm sensor for pipes under your sink. Typically, these alarms range from 100 dB to 120 dB, ensuring you can hear them clearly even in enclosed spaces like basements. If you have a large or noisy area, opting for a sensor with a higher volume rating, like 120 dB, can be particularly advantageous. Some freeze alarms even come with adjustable volume settings, allowing you to customize the loudness to fit your needs. Additionally, many models include a visual alert, such as a flashing light, which works alongside the audible alarm to notify you of leaks or freezing temperatures, helping you take immediate action.
Wireless Connectivity Options
Choosing the right wireless connectivity option for your freeze alarm sensor can greatly impact its effectiveness. Wi-Fi-enabled sensors offer real-time alerts to your smartphone, but they need a stable internet connection and can be affected by network congestion. If you’re in a smaller home, a Bluetooth sensor might be a better fit, as it connects directly to your phone but has a shorter range. For larger properties with multiple disconnects, consider long-range technologies like LoRa or Sub-1G, which provide better coverage and penetration through walls. Many wireless sensors don’t require a hub for setup, streamlining installation and saving costs, while others may offer advanced features when connected to a central hub. Choose wisely to enhance your home’s protection.

Waterproof Rating Importance
When it comes to freeze alarm sensors, a solid waterproof rating is essential for ensuring reliable performance, especially in the damp conditions found under sinks. Look for ratings like IP66 or IP67, as they indicate the sensor’s ability to resist water ingress, making them suitable for high-humidity environments. Higher waterproof ratings can withstand accidental spills and moisture, ensuring accurate operation without false alarms. This protection is vital for the sensitive electronics inside the sensor, preventing damage from water exposure. A good waterproof rating means your device remains functional during plumbing leaks or condensation buildup. Plus, products with better ratings generally have longer lifespans and require less maintenance, giving you peace of mind against potential water damage.
